Tour Details
Visitors can expect to explore a trio of remarkable canyons during this tour – Dry Fork, Peekaboo, and the renowned Spooky Slot Canyon.
The adventure begins with a 45-minute to 1-hour drive on a dirt road to the Dry Fork trailhead. From there, hikers will embark on a 3-mile loop through the canyons.
Spooky Slot Canyon, known for its narrow 10-inch passages, offers an optional challenge, while Peekaboo Canyon impresses with its unique sandstone formations and arches.
Along the way, knowledgeable guides provide insights and ensure the safety and comfort of the small group, limited to just 6 participants.

What to Expect in the Canyons
The slot canyons of Dry Fork, Peekaboo, and Spooky offer a captivating and immersive exploration for adventurous visitors.
Hiking through these narrow, winding passages, travelers are met with stunning sandstone formations and natural arches.
Spooky Slot Canyon, renowned for its tight confines reaching as narrow as 10 inches, presents an optional challenge for the daring.
Peekaboo Canyon, on the other hand, showcases the unique sculpting of the rock, creating awe-inspiring vistas.
Throughout the 3-mile loop, guides provide insightful commentary on the geology and history of this remarkable landscape within the Grand Staircase-Escalante National Monument.
The journey through these slot canyons promises an unforgettable adventure for those seeking an up-close encounter with the Southwest’s natural wonders.
